Bell Ringer Arrested for Public Intoxication

SPONSOR

12:00 Wednesday | Texarkana, Arkansas Police arrested the Salvation Army bell ringer at Walmart around noon today.

Police responded after firemen on scene reported the bell ringer was incoherent and possibly intoxicated.

According to Texarkana, Arkansas public information officer Kristi Mitchell, “Today at noon TAPD responded to 133 Arkansas Blvd in reference to a possible intoxicated person. Upon arrival it was determined that Bryon White, 42 years old, was intoxicated and arrested for public intoxication.”

“White was transported to the BiState Jail,” Said Mitchell.
